Two YouTubers Arrested for Security Breach at World Cup Game

Two Argentine YouTubers, Beni Marmol and Pato Perrotta, were arrested at Hard Rock Stadium in Miami Gardens during a World Cup game. They were part of a group of 16 individuals apprehended for allegedly bypassing security.

Beni Marmol, 20, and Pato Perrotta, 26, both Argentine content creators, were arrested along with 14 other individuals at Hard Rock Stadium in Miami Gardens on Saturday. The arrests occurred during the final Group K match of the World Cup.
